Output d96024a141b01ae2d91c92b641b5e9cfb2529db95b8b1839718bb45afe878ba8:6

value
9380687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48c764e6f665c28d7efdffce72a9f73c63202b50 OP_EQUAL
address
38KqSWBQeYF5jyh3tfJQpfCkr6ZXd2HYQL
transaction
d96024a141b01ae2d91c92b641b5e9cfb2529db95b8b1839718bb45afe878ba8
spent
true